The Rise of AI Powered Creative Collaboration

Marketing has become increasingly complex as brands communicate with customers across websites, social media, streaming platforms, search engines, email campaigns, and mobile applications. Managing these touchpoints requires speed, precision, and creativity.

Creative AI Teams bridge this gap by combining skilled marketers, writers, designers, strategists, and AI specialists into a unified workflow. Artificial intelligence supports data analysis, content generation, audience segmentation, and campaign forecasting, while human professionals shape the emotional message and creative direction.

This partnership allows businesses to create campaigns that are innovative without losing authenticity.

Turning Consumer Data into Creative Opportunities

Every online interaction generates valuable information about customer interests and behaviors. Brands that know how to interpret this information gain a significant competitive advantage.

Creative AI Teams use advanced analytics to examine purchasing habits, search intent, customer reviews, browsing behavior, and engagement metrics. These insights reveal patterns that help marketers understand what audiences truly value.

Rather than creating generic messages, teams develop campaigns tailored to specific customer groups. Personalized storytelling increases trust, strengthens relationships, and improves overall campaign effectiveness.

Accelerating the Creative Process

One of the biggest challenges for modern marketers is keeping up with the demand for fresh content. Businesses must consistently publish articles, videos, social media posts, advertisements, landing pages, and promotional materials.

Creative AI Teams accelerate production by automating repetitive tasks such as keyword research, campaign scheduling, content outlines, image suggestions, and performance reporting. This saves valuable time that creative professionals can use to refine ideas and develop stronger narratives.

The result is a faster production cycle without compromising originality or quality.

Smarter Decision Making Through AI Insights

Marketing decisions often involve uncertainty. Choosing the right audience, selecting appropriate channels, and developing compelling messages require careful planning.

Creative AI Teams reduce uncertainty by using predictive analytics and performance modeling. AI evaluates historical campaign data, customer behavior, seasonal trends, and market changes to recommend strategies with higher success potential.

Human marketers review these recommendations and adapt them according to brand objectives, ensuring that every campaign reflects business goals as well as customer expectations.

Ethical Innovation Builds Customer Confidence

Consumers increasingly value transparency and responsible technology. Businesses that misuse artificial intelligence risk damaging their reputation and losing customer trust.

Creative AI Teams establish clear quality control processes for reviewing AI generated content, verifying facts, protecting customer data, and maintaining originality. Human oversight ensures every campaign meets ethical standards while accurately representing the brand.

Responsible innovation strengthens customer confidence and supports sustainable business growth.
